Tony Dungy's 'The Uncommon Man' shares leadership principles drawn from his coaching career and Christian faith, emphasizing character, humility, and servant leadership.

Dungy combines personal anecdotes with practical advice for men seeking to live purposefully in family, work, and community.

The book highlights his belief that success is measured by integrity and influence rather than accolades alone.

Throughout, he offers guidance on mentoring, spiritual growth, and building strong teams grounded in moral conviction.

The work appeals to readers interested in sports leadership, faith-based living, and practical wisdom for everyday challenges.
